Coros Dura Solar GPS Bike Computer - Text Review

Introduction

The Coros Dura Solar GPS Bike Computer is Coros’s debut in the cycling computer market, targeting cyclists interested in long-distance rides and bike packing adventures. Its standout feature is its impressive battery life, offering up to 120 hours on a full charge, extended further with solar charging. This makes it ideal for riders who prioritize reliability and minimal charging interruptions.

Design & Build Quality

Featuring a 2.7-inch color touchscreen and a digital scroll dial, the Dura ensures easy navigation. Its lightweight design (99g) and rugged build make it suitable for various riding conditions. The device is also IP67-rated, offering protection against dust and water ingress. 

Performance & Features

The Dura excels in performance, boasting dual-frequency GPS for accurate tracking and smart rerouting capabilities. It supports ANT+, Bluetooth, and Wi-Fi connectivity, allowing seamless integration with sensors and third-party apps like Strava. The device also offers a comprehensive training hub, providing customizable workouts and training plans. 

Pros:
•    Exceptional battery life (up to 120 hours)
•    Solar charging capability
•    Dual-frequency GPS for accurate tracking
•    User-friendly interface with touchscreen and scroll dial
•    Seamless integration with sensors and third-party apps


Cons:
•    Smaller screen size compared to some competitors
•    Occasional lag in rerouting
•    Initial compatibility issues with Garmin mounts

Verdict:
The Coros Dura stands out as a reliable and feature-rich GPS cycling computer, offering exceptional battery life and performance at a competitive price point. While it may have some minor drawbacks, its overall value makes it a strong contender in the cycling computer market.
